在 System.Core.dll 中發生 其他信息: “object”未包含“Id”的定義 Id屬性是肯定存在 ...
一 起因: 最近在做的一個項目,因為很多地方要用到同一套流程。為了后期維護,要求將共用流程進行抽離,創建為一個公用的類庫。在抽離之前程序運行是沒有問題的,然而在抽離之后就得到了如題錯誤: object不包含xxx的定義。遇到這個錯誤時也是相當的郁悶,根本就覺得莫名奇妙,完全相同的代碼,只是拿出來以類庫的形式調用而已。 二 查找: 遇到問題總得想法子解決,接下來就是進行調試,調試下來就更是摸不着頭腦 ...
2017-04-20 11:15 4 3552 推薦指數:
在 System.Core.dll 中發生 其他信息: “object”未包含“Id”的定義 Id屬性是肯定存在 ...
dynamic關鍵字可充當C#類型系統中的靜態類型聲明。這樣,C#就獲得了動態功能,同時仍然作為靜態類型化語言而存在。 Var與dynamic: var實際上編譯器拋給我們的語法糖,一旦被編譯,編譯器就會自動匹配var變量的實際類型,並用實際類型來替換該變量的聲明,等同於我們在編碼時使用了實際 ...
閱讀目錄: 一. 為什么是它們三個 二. 能夠任意賦值的原因 三. dynamic的用法 四. 使用dynamic的注意事項 一. 為什么是它們三個? 拿這三者比較的原因是它們在使用的時候非常相似。你可以用它們聲明的變量賦任何類型的值。 看看下面的示例 ...
dynamic類型簡單示例 動態添加字段 枚舉該對象所有成員 轉載:https://www.cnblogs.com/hnsongbiao/p/8250956.html ...
dynamic類型簡單示例 動態添加字段 枚舉該對象所有成員 ...
Dynamic類型是C#4.0中引入的新類型,它允許其操作掠過編譯器類型檢查,而在運行時處理。 編程語言有時可以划分為靜態類型化語言和動態類型化語言。C#和Java經常被認為是靜態化類型的語言,而Python、Ruby和JavaScript是動態類型語言。一般而言,動態語言在編譯時不會對類型 ...
dynamic類型 簡單示例 dynamic expando = new System.Dynamic.ExpandoObject(); //動態類型字段 可讀可寫 expando.Id = 1; expando.Name = "Test"; string json ...
dynamic類型 方法一:簡單示例 方法二:動態添加字段 List<string> fieldList = new List<string>() { "Name","Age","Sex"}; //From config or db ...